Member: 1759686 Status: Offline Thanks Meter: 45 | Repair imei g925f 7.0 not ok Phone must be rooted! If the software can't root the phone automatically, then you must root your device manually. 1. Power on the phone. 2. Tap 7 times on 'Build number' in 'Settings'-'About phone' to enable 'Developer options', go to 'Settings'-'Developer options' and enable 'USB debugging'. 3. Connect the phone to PC with USB cable, install drivers if needed. 4. Select device in ADB settings. 5. Press 'Read EFS' button to read backup or 'Write EFS' to restore. 6. Press 'Write CERT' to restore certificates. 7. Press 'Write NV DATA' if you need to restore NV backup. Read certificate operation: 1. Power on the phone. 2. Connect the phone to PC with USB cable. 3. Check Samsung modem in device manager, install drivers if needed. 4. Press 'Read CERT' button to read certificates.
